A map of Northwestern United States and neighboring Canadian Provinces / prepared in the Cartographic Section of the National Geographic Society for the National geographic magazine ; James M. Darley, chief cartographer.

Creator:
National Geographic Society (U.S.). Cartographic Section
Published/Created:
Washington :
The Society,
1941
Physical Description:
1 map : col. ; 58 x 87 cm.
Notes:
"Culture by Apphia E. Holdstock. Research by Wellman Chamberlin. Physiography by John J. Brehm."
Issued with the National geographic magazine, v. 79, no. 6, June 1941.
Relief shown by hachures and spot heights.
Shows routes of exploration and includes notes on historical sites and points of interest.
